Blurb:
A field of strawberries in Kent ... And sitting in it two caravans - one for the men and one for the women. The residents are from all over: miner's son Andriy is from the old Ukraine, while sexy young Irina is from the new: they eye each other warily. There are the Poles Tomasz and Yola, two Chinese girls and Emanuel from Malawi. They're all here to pick strawberries in England's green and pleasant land. But these days England's not so pleasant for immigrants. Not with Russian gangster-wannabes like Vulk, who's taken a shine to Irina and thinks kidnapping is a wooing strategy. And so Andriy - who really doesn't fancy Irina, honest - must set off in search of that girl he's not in love with.
Both funny and insightful. An absurdist look into Britain's (illegal) immigant community.

Journal Entry 4 by MarthaK-H from Lewisham, Greater London United Kingdom on Wednesday, May 21, 2008
I found the story both amusing & devastating. I think we all have an idea of how immigrants to the UK are mistreated and this is an eventful & funny tale following a somewhat bizarre group and their adventures one summer which all start off with harmless strawberry picking in Kent.
It's an interesting read as well as a comic (rather black humour at times!) tale. I actually really liked the commentary from dog as well as each of the characters.
